• Admin

Key Considerations When Implementing Cross-Chain Solutions

In the rapidly evolving landscape of blockchain technology, cross-chain solutions have emerged as a crucial component for enhancing interoperability among various blockchain networks. However, implementing these solutions requires careful consideration to ensure security, efficiency, and scalability. Below are key considerations to keep in mind when designing and deploying cross-chain solutions.

1. Security Protocols
Security should be a top priority when implementing cross-chain solutions. Each blockchain has its own set of security protocols. It is essential to assess the security measures of all involved networks. Utilize thorough security audits to ensure that vulnerabilities aren’t introduced during asset transfers or interactions between chains.

2. Consensus Mechanisms
Different blockchains use various consensus mechanisms like Proof of Work, Proof of Stake, or Delegated Proof of Stake. Understanding these mechanisms is vital for ensuring seamless communication between chains. Cross-chain solutions should be designed to account for these differences, allowing transactions to be validated and confirmed effectively across networks.

3. Interoperability Standards
Adhering to established interoperability standards is crucial for cross-chain communications. Standards such as the Inter-Blockchain Communication (IBC) Protocol can facilitate smoother interactions between chains. Utilizing well-defined standards can significantly minimize compatibility issues and streamline transactions.

4. Scalability Challenges
As blockchain networks grow, scalability becomes a major consideration. Ensure that the chosen cross-chain solution can handle the volume of transactions anticipated. Evaluate the performance limits of both the source and destination chains to maintain system efficiency and avoid bottlenecks.

5. User Experience (UX)
A seamless user experience is essential for the adoption of cross-chain solutions. Design interfaces that make it easy for users to engage with different chains without encountering complex processes. Intuitive navigation and clear information on transaction statuses can enhance user satisfaction and confidence in cross-chain capabilities.

6. Transaction Fees
Transaction fees can vary significantly between different blockchain networks. When implementing cross-chain solutions, evaluate the cost, speed, and potential hurdles associated with transferring assets from one chain to another. A detailed understanding of these costs will assist in strategizing the most efficient pathways for users.

7. Regulatory Compliance
As the blockchain industry matures, regulatory scrutiny continues to tighten. Ensure that your cross-chain solutions comply with relevant legal requirements across jurisdictions. This includes adhering to KYC (Know Your Customer) and AML (Anti-Money Laundering) regulations when necessary, as failure to do so can lead to significant legal challenges.

8. Reliability and Downtime
Reliability is crucial for cross-chain solutions. Ensure that the technology used can handle downtimes, whether caused by network issues or unexpected downtimes of connected chains. Implement fallback mechanisms and multi-chain backup strategies to enhance reliability and ensure smooth operations.

By carefully considering these factors, organizations can effectively implement cross-chain solutions that enhance blockchain interoperability, optimize performance, and foster user trust. The future of blockchain technology greatly depends on these advancements, making it essential for businesses to stay informed and proactive in their approach to cross-chain implementation.